Kentucky Pushes Mining Tax-Breaks in Bid to Attract Crypto Community
The Kentucky House Budget Committee approved a bill in a 19-2 vote to eliminate the sales tax on electricity for use in cryptocurrency mining operations. The bill, designed to attract more miners to the state, is now in the Kentucky Senate for review. дальше »

Iran Shuts Down 1,620 Cryptocurrency Mining Farms
Since Iran began recognizing cryptocurrency mining as an industry, it has reportedly shut down 1,620 unauthorized crypto mining farms. Crypto miners initially welcomed the recognition but later said that the electricity tariffs were too high. дальше »

Here’s Why Hosting Your Mining Farm in Kazakhstan is a Good Idea
Kazakhstan is one of the world’s best destinations for crypto mining: electricity costs just $0. 04/kWh and there is no tax on mining revenue. It’s also relatively easy to start a mining business in Kazakhstan through specialized hosting companies even if you are located abroad. дальше »

Iran Licenses 14 Bitcoin Mining Farms, Cuts Electricity Tariff up to 47% for Miners
Iran has reportedly issued permits for 14 bitcoin mining farms and will cut up to 47% off of the electricity tariff in order to support authorized cryptocurrency mining centers. Crypto miners will soon have to register with the government. дальше »

Bitcoin Mining Hotspot Iran Drafts Electricity Tariffs for Crypto Miners
The government of Iran has opted to introduce specific electricity prices for cryptocurrency mining. The west Asian country, which has had a complicated relationship with cryptocurrency in the past, plans to set prices around the same tariffs that are used for exporting electricity. дальше »
